Solidifying and Cooling Down Process



Upon conclusion of the pouring procedure, the molten light weight aluminum shifts right into the solidifying and cooling down phase, a critical point in the aluminum spreading procedure that directly influences the final item's stability and characteristics. As the light weight aluminum begins to cool, its particles arrange themselves right into a solid type, progressively taking on the form of the mold. The price at which the aluminum cools is important, as it affects the product's microstructure and mechanical residential properties. Quick cooling can lead to a finer grain framework, enhancing the material's toughness, while slower cooling may bring about larger grain sizes, influencing the end product's ductility.




Throughout this stage, it is vital to control the cooling process thoroughly to avoid problems such as porosity, shrinkage, or internal tensions. Various cooling approaches, such as air cooling, water quenching, or regulated air conditioning chambers, can be utilized based on the specific needs of the spreading (about aluminum casting). By checking and managing the solidification and cooling down process, producers can ensure the manufacturing of high-grade light weight aluminum castings with the desired mechanical and metallurgical residential or commercial properties

Kinds Of Light Weight Aluminum Casting Procedures



Given the varied advantages that aluminum spreading services supply, it is important to understand the different sorts of processes entailed in casting aluminum elements. Light weight aluminum casting processes are extensively classified into 2 major types: expendable mold and mildew spreading and permanent mold and mildew spreading.




Expendable mold and mildew spreading includes approaches like sand spreading, investment casting, and plaster mold and mildew spreading. Sand casting is among one of the most usual and versatile techniques, appropriate for both tiny and large manufacturing. Investment spreading, likewise recognized as lost-wax casting, is liked for complex layouts and high accuracy. Plaster mold and mildew spreading, on the various other hand, is made use of for generating components with fine details and smooth surfaces.


Long-term mold casting involves procedures like die spreading and irreversible mold and mildew casting. Die casting is a highly automated procedure ideal for high-volume manufacturing of complicated shapes with excellent surface area coating. Long-term mold and mildew casting, on the other hand, is an affordable method for medium to high-volume manufacturing, using great dimensional accuracy and repeatability. Recognizing these various kinds of aluminum spreading processes is essential for choosing one of the most appropriate method for details task demands.

High Quality Control Measures in Light Weight Aluminum Spreading



casting aluminumcasting aluminum
Reliable quality assurance procedures are essential in making sure the accuracy and uniformity of aluminum casting procedures. Preserving rigorous high quality criteria throughout the casting procedure is vital to assure the structural stability and efficiency of the last aluminum items. One crucial quality assurance procedure is using advanced technology for tracking and checking the spreading procedure at numerous phases. This consists of using techniques such as X-ray evaluations, ultrasonic testing, and visual evaluations to find any kind of issues or incongruities in the actors light weight aluminum parts.


In addition, carrying out standardized procedures and methods for top quality control aids in lessening errors this link and discrepancies during spreading. Routine calibration of equipment and devices is crucial to guarantee accurate dimensions and casting specs are met. Quality assurance actions also entail extensive screening of the chemical composition and mechanical residential or commercial properties of the light weight aluminum material prior to and after casting to confirm its integrity and adherence to called for requirements.

The origins of CNC machines is often traced back to John Parsons. He is credited with developing the very first numerical Command machine in 1949, which was meant to run straight off a set of punch playing cards that told the machine wherever to maneuver.
